The Huntsville Junior Service League thrives on the motto of: “What we do only has value if we give it away.” -Anonymous
Below is a list of ongoing projects that we, as a League, stand behind with our full heart and soul. We are always looking for new opportunities to serve Walker County. In addition to these regular opportunities, we contribute to other local organizations by donating items and providing our time to serve as needs are identified.

Community Involvement:
- Care Center Banquet: League members serve dinner to attendees and assist in the auction for the annual fundraiser. (Annually, October)
- Care Center BBQ Fundraiser: League members assemble sandwiches and assist with collecting money from donors at this annual event. (Annually, January)
- Lasso Your Imagination benefitting the Dolly Parton Imagination Library: League members provide desserts for the auction at the annual fundraiser. (Annually, September)
- Ducks Unlimited Banquet: League members serve dinner to attendees of the annual fundraiser. (Annually, February)
- Good Shepherd Mission: League members collect and donate canned goods for the GSM pantry.
- Head Start Pre–K: League members help Head Start families during the Christmas season through the adoption of children from their angel tree.
- Literacy Initiatives: League members fundraised and purchased Little Free Libraries for several HISD campuses. League members have also collected and purchased books to contribute to the libraries.
- Mobile Food Truck: The League arranges for an 18-wheeler of food from the Houston Food Bank to travel to Walker County and provide fresh produce and other groceries to citizens in need. (Multiple weekends each month)
- Say Yes to the Dress: The league helps to provide a solution for high school girls who are unable to purchase a prom dress, so they can attend their prom without that expense. (Annually, April)
- School Hygiene Project: League members donate various hygiene products to schools in Walker County. Items consist of toiletries, laundry soap, lice treatment kits, undergarments, etc. (Monthly)
- Special Kids Rodeo: The League provides snacks and drinks to Special Education students from area schools attending Walker County Fair activities. (Annually, April)
- Walker County Warrior Banquet benefiting Mighty Oaks Foundation: League members greet and guide attendees, and assist with the auction for the annual fundraiser. (Annually, January)
Scholarship:
- Endowed Scholarship: Each year, we award a scholarship to a graduating high school senior to help fund school-related expenses at Sam Houston State University.
